[-]
[+]
|
Deleted |
_service:tar_git:kf5-filesystem.spec
|
@@ -1,75 +0,0 @@
-#
-# Do NOT Edit the Auto-generated Part!
-# Generated by: spectacle version 0.27
-#
-
-Name: kf5-filesystem
-
-# >> macros
-# << macros
-
-Summary: Filesystem and RPM macros for KDE Frameworks 5
-Version: 5.1.0
-Release: 1
-Group: System/Base
-License: BSD
-BuildArch: noarch
-URL: http://www.kde.org
-Source0: macros.kf5
-Source100: kf5-filesystem.yaml
-
-%description
-Filesystem and RPM macros for KDE Frameworks 5.
-
-%package -n kf5-rpm-macros
-Summary: RPM macros for KDE Frameworks 5
-Group: Development/System
-Requires: %{name} = %{version}-%{release}
-Requires: qt5-qmake
-
-%description -n kf5-rpm-macros
-RPM macros for building KDE Frameworks 5 packages.
-
-%prep
-# No setup
-
-# >> setup
-# << setup
-
-%build
-# >> build pre
-# << build pre
-
-
-
-# >> build post
-# << build post
-
-%install
-rm -rf %{buildroot}
-# >> install pre
-# << install pre
-
-# >> install post
-# See macros.kf5 where the directories are specified
-mkdir -p %{buildroot}%{_datadir}/kf5
-mkdir -p %{buildroot}%{_includedir}/KF5
-mkdir -p %{buildroot}%{_prefix}/%{_lib}/libexec/kf5
-
-mkdir -p %{buildroot}%{_sysconfdir}/rpm/
-install -pm644 %{_sourcedir}/macros.kf5 %{buildroot}%{_sysconfdir}/rpm/
-# << install post
-
-%files
-%defattr(-,root,root,-)
-%{_datadir}/kf5
-%{_includedir}/KF5
-%{_prefix}/%{_lib}/libexec/kf5
-# >> files
-# << files
-
-%files -n kf5-rpm-macros
-%defattr(-,root,root,-)
-%config(noreplace) %{_sysconfdir}/rpm/macros.kf5
-# >> files kf5-rpm-macros
-# << files kf5-rpm-macros
|
[-]
[+]
|
Added |
kf5-filesystem.spec
^
|
|
[-]
[+]
|
Deleted |
_service
^
|
@@ -1,7 +0,0 @@
-<services>
- <service name="tar_git">
- <param name="url">https://github.com/maui-packages/kf5-filesystem.git</param>
- <param name="branch">master</param>
- <param name="dumb">Y</param>
- </service>
-</services>
|
[-]
[+]
|
Deleted |
_service:tar_git:kf5-filesystem.yaml
^
|
@@ -1,31 +0,0 @@
-Name : kf5-filesystem
-Version : 5.1.0
-Release : 1
-Group : System/Base
-License : BSD
-Summary : Filesystem and RPM macros for KDE Frameworks 5
-Description : Filesystem and RPM macros for KDE Frameworks 5.
-URL : http://www.kde.org
-Sources :
- - macros.kf5
-NoSetup : yes
-BuildArch : noarch
-
-Configure : none
-Builder : none
-
-Files:
- - "%{_datadir}/kf5"
- - "%{_includedir}/KF5"
- - "%{_prefix}/%{_lib}/libexec/kf5"
-
-SubPackages:
- - Name: kf5-rpm-macros
- AsWholeName: yes
- Group: Development/System
- Summary: RPM macros for KDE Frameworks 5
- Description: RPM macros for building KDE Frameworks 5 packages.
- Requires:
- - qt5-qmake
- Files:
- - "%config(noreplace) %{_sysconfdir}/rpm/macros.kf5"
|
[-]
[+]
|
Deleted |
_service:tar_git:macros.kf5
^
|
@@ -1,65 +0,0 @@
-%_kf5_prefix %{_prefix}
-%_kf5_bindir %{_kf5_prefix}/bin
-%_kf5_sharedir %{_datadir}
-%_kf5_datadir %{_kf5_sharedir}/kf5
-%_kf5_docdir %{_docdir}
-%_kf5_includedir %{_includedir}/KF5
-%_kf5_libdir %{_kf5_prefix}/%{_lib}
-%_kf5_libexecdir %{_kf5_libdir}/libexec/kf5
-%_kf5_mandir %{_kf5_sharedir}/man
-%_kf5_sbindir %{_sbindir}
-%_kf5_notifydir %{_kf5_sharedir}/knotifications5
-%_kf5_sysconfdir %{_sysconfdir}
-%_kf5_plugindir %{_qt5_plugindir}
-%_kf5_plasmadir %{_kf5_sharedir}/plasma
-%_kf5_importdir %{_qt5_importdir}
-%_kf5_qmldir %{_kf5_prefix}/%{_lib}/qt5/qml
-%_kf5_cmakedir %{_kf5_libdir}/cmake
-%_kf5_mkspecsdir %{_qt5_datadir}/mkspecs/modules
-%_kf5_dbusinterfacesdir %{_kf5_sharedir}/dbus-1/interfaces
-%_kf5_configdir %{_kf5_sysconfdir}/xdg
-%_kf5_applicationsdir %{_kf5_sharedir}/applications
-%_kf5_iconsdir %{_kf5_sharedir}/icons
-%_kf5_wallpapersdir %{_kf5_sharedir}/wallpapers
-%_kf5_appsdir %{_kf5_sharedir}
-%_kf5_configkcfgdir %{_kf5_sharedir}/config.kcfg
-%_kf5_servicesdir %{_kf5_sharedir}/kservices5
-%_kf5_servicetypesdir %{_kf5_sharedir}/kservicetypes5
-%_kf5_htmldir %{_kf5_sharedir}/doc/HTML
-%_kf5_build_type RelWithDebInfo
-
-%cmake_kf5(d:) \
- bdir=. \
- %{-d:dir=%{-d*} \
- mkdir $dir \
- cd $dir \
- bdir=.. } \
- cmake -DCMAKE_BUILD_TYPE=%{_kf5_build_type} \\\
- -DCMAKE_C_FLAGS="%{optflags} -DNDEBUG" \\\
- -DCMAKE_CXX_FLAGS="%{optflags} -DNDEBUG" \\\
- -DCMAKE_EXE_LINKER_FLAGS="-Wl,--as-needed -Wl,--no-undefined -Wl,-Bsymbolic-functions" \\\
- -DCMAKE_MODULE_LINKER_FLAGS="-Wl,--as-needed -Wl,--no-undefined -Wl,-Bsymbolic-functions" \\\
- -DCMAKE_SHARED_LINKER_FLAGS="-Wl,--as-needed -Wl,--no-undefined -Wl,-Bsymbolic-functions" \\\
- -DCMAKE_INSTALL_PREFIX=%{_kf5_prefix} \\\
- -DCMAKE_PREFIX_PATH=%{_kf5_prefix} \\\
- -DKF5_INCLUDE_INSTALL_DIR=include/KF5 \\\
- -DLIB_INSTALL_DIR=%{_lib} \\\
- -DSYSCONF_INSTALL_DIR=%{_kf5_sysconfdir} \\\
- -DQT_PLUGIN_INSTALL_DIR=%{_lib}/qt5/plugins \\\
- -DPLUGIN_INSTALL_DIR=%{_lib}/qt5/plugins \\\
- -DQML_INSTALL_DIR=%{_lib}/qt5/qml \\\
- -DIMPORTS_INSTALL_DIR=%{_lib}/qt5/imports \\\
- -DECM_MKSPECS_INSTALL_DIR=%{_kf5_mkspecsdir} \\\
- -DBUILD_TESTING=OFF \\\
- $bdir %* \
-%{nil}
-
-%cmake_kf5_install \
- make VERBOSE=1 DESTDIR=%{?buildroot:%{buildroot}} install
-
-%kf5_make \
- %cmake_kf5 -d build \
- %{__make} %{?_smp_mflags}
-
-%kf5_make_install \
- %cmake_kf5_install -C build
|
[-]
[+]
|
Added |
kf5-filesystem.yaml
^
|
@@ -0,0 +1,31 @@
+Name : kf5-filesystem
+Version : 5.3.0
+Release : 1
+Group : System/Base
+License : BSD
+Summary : Filesystem and RPM macros for KDE Frameworks 5
+Description : Filesystem and RPM macros for KDE Frameworks 5.
+URL : http://www.kde.org
+Sources :
+ - macros.kf5
+NoSetup : yes
+BuildArch : noarch
+
+Configure : none
+Builder : none
+
+Files:
+ - "%{_datadir}/kf5"
+ - "%{_includedir}/KF5"
+ - "%{_prefix}/%{_lib}/libexec/kf5"
+
+SubPackages:
+ - Name: kf5-rpm-macros
+ AsWholeName: yes
+ Group: Development/System
+ Summary: RPM macros for KDE Frameworks 5
+ Description: RPM macros for building KDE Frameworks 5 packages.
+ Requires:
+ - qt5-qmake
+ Files:
+ - "%config(noreplace) %{_sysconfdir}/rpm/macros.kf5"
|
[-]
[+]
|
Added |
macros.kf5
^
|
@@ -0,0 +1,65 @@
+%_kf5_prefix %{_prefix}
+%_kf5_bindir %{_kf5_prefix}/bin
+%_kf5_sharedir %{_datadir}
+%_kf5_datadir %{_kf5_sharedir}/kf5
+%_kf5_docdir %{_docdir}
+%_kf5_includedir %{_includedir}/KF5
+%_kf5_libdir %{_kf5_prefix}/%{_lib}
+%_kf5_libexecdir %{_kf5_libdir}/libexec/kf5
+%_kf5_mandir %{_kf5_sharedir}/man
+%_kf5_sbindir %{_sbindir}
+%_kf5_notifydir %{_kf5_sharedir}/knotifications5
+%_kf5_sysconfdir %{_sysconfdir}
+%_kf5_plugindir %{_qt5_plugindir}
+%_kf5_plasmadir %{_kf5_sharedir}/plasma
+%_kf5_importdir %{_qt5_importdir}
+%_kf5_qmldir %{_kf5_prefix}/%{_lib}/qt5/qml
+%_kf5_cmakedir %{_kf5_libdir}/cmake
+%_kf5_mkspecsdir %{_qt5_datadir}/mkspecs/modules
+%_kf5_dbusinterfacesdir %{_kf5_sharedir}/dbus-1/interfaces
+%_kf5_configdir %{_kf5_sysconfdir}/xdg
+%_kf5_applicationsdir %{_kf5_sharedir}/applications
+%_kf5_iconsdir %{_kf5_sharedir}/icons
+%_kf5_wallpapersdir %{_kf5_sharedir}/wallpapers
+%_kf5_appsdir %{_kf5_sharedir}
+%_kf5_configkcfgdir %{_kf5_sharedir}/config.kcfg
+%_kf5_servicesdir %{_kf5_sharedir}/kservices5
+%_kf5_servicetypesdir %{_kf5_sharedir}/kservicetypes5
+%_kf5_htmldir %{_kf5_sharedir}/doc/HTML
+%_kf5_build_type RelWithDebInfo
+
+%cmake_kf5(d:) \
+ bdir=. \
+ %{-d:dir=%{-d*} \
+ mkdir $dir \
+ cd $dir \
+ bdir=.. } \
+ cmake -DCMAKE_BUILD_TYPE=%{_kf5_build_type} \\\
+ -DCMAKE_C_FLAGS="%{optflags} -DNDEBUG" \\\
+ -DCMAKE_CXX_FLAGS="%{optflags} -DNDEBUG" \\\
+ -DCMAKE_EXE_LINKER_FLAGS="-Wl,--as-needed -Wl,--no-undefined -Wl,-Bsymbolic-functions" \\\
+ -DCMAKE_MODULE_LINKER_FLAGS="-Wl,--as-needed -Wl,--no-undefined -Wl,-Bsymbolic-functions" \\\
+ -DCMAKE_SHARED_LINKER_FLAGS="-Wl,--as-needed -Wl,--no-undefined -Wl,-Bsymbolic-functions" \\\
+ -DCMAKE_INSTALL_PREFIX=%{_kf5_prefix} \\\
+ -DCMAKE_PREFIX_PATH=%{_kf5_prefix} \\\
+ -DKF5_INCLUDE_INSTALL_DIR=include/KF5 \\\
+ -DLIB_INSTALL_DIR=%{_lib} \\\
+ -DSYSCONF_INSTALL_DIR=%{_kf5_sysconfdir} \\\
+ -DQT_PLUGIN_INSTALL_DIR=%{_lib}/qt5/plugins \\\
+ -DPLUGIN_INSTALL_DIR=%{_lib}/qt5/plugins \\\
+ -DQML_INSTALL_DIR=%{_lib}/qt5/qml \\\
+ -DIMPORTS_INSTALL_DIR=%{_lib}/qt5/imports \\\
+ -DECM_MKSPECS_INSTALL_DIR=%{_kf5_mkspecsdir} \\\
+ -DBUILD_TESTING=OFF \\\
+ $bdir %* \
+%{nil}
+
+%cmake_kf5_install \
+ make VERBOSE=1 DESTDIR=%{?buildroot:%{buildroot}} install
+
+%kf5_make \
+ %cmake_kf5 -d build \
+ %{__make} %{?_smp_mflags}
+
+%kf5_make_install \
+ %cmake_kf5_install -C build
|